Ottawa Senators Agree To Terms With Zack MacEwen
Pro Hockey RumorsThe Ottawa Senators have added some physicality to their bottom six, signing forward Zack MacEwen to a three-year contract worth $2.325MM...
Published: Jul 6, 2023, 2:46 pm Added: Jul 6, 2023, 3:31 pm